New York Knicks All-Star Jalen Brunson expressed surprise regarding Myles Turner's departure from the Indiana Pacers to the Milwaukee Bucks on a four-year, $108.9 million deal. Brunson, speaking on his podcast, called the situation "weird," noting Turner had recently reflected on his decade with the Pacers before abruptly leaving.
Following Turner's exit, the Pacers acquired center Jay Huff from the Memphis Grizzlies as their initial replacement. This move was praised by The Athletic as one of the best under-the-radar transactions of the NBA offseason. Concurrently, criticism emerged from an unnamed agent who accused the Pacers of consistently undervaluing and disrespecting Turner over the years, particularly during trade deadlines and contract negotiations. The agent stated Turner played below market value on his last contract and claimed the Pacers expected him to take another pay cut this offseason to avoid the luxury tax, making his departure unexpected.
